“Hurricane” is the lead single from Donda, the song was highly expected after being one of the biggest leaks from the Yandhi era.

The song was first previewed by Kanye West in an Instagram post on September 14, 2018. It was later previewed on September 27, 2018, in a tweet featuring a caption that would tease the original release date of his scrapped album, Yandhi.

“Hurricane” would later appear on earlier tracklists for Donda in July 2020. On July 22, 2020, Kanye posted a now deleted tweet, claiming Lil Baby was his favorite rapper but wouldn’t work with him. Lil Baby then responded claiming he wasn’t aware of the refusal.

Lil Baby would later be flown out to Wyoming to work with Kanye on Donda, and info would later surface that he would be featured on “Hurricane.”

The track was officially played at the first public listening party for Donda, which happened at the Mercedes-Benz Stadium on July 22, 2021.

“Hurricane” has seen dozens of unreleased versions, with verses from Young Thug, Ty Dolla $ign, Big Sean, 6ix9ine, KayCyy, 070 Shake, Ant Clemons, Consequence, Vic Mensa, Lil Yachty, Rooga & many more.
